Boost Your Credit Score: A Step-by-Step Guide
Improving your credit score can seem like a daunting task, but it's absolutely achievable with the right strategies. Begin website by reviewing your credit report for any discrepancies. Address any issues you find with the respective credit bureaus. Next, concentrate on fulfilling your payments promptly. This demonstrates responsibility to lenders and can positively impact your score.
Additionally, control your credit utilization ratio below 30%. This means using less than 30% of your available limit. Open new credit cautiously and avoid applying for too much credit at once. Finally, cultivate a positive credit history by leveraging different types of credit. By implementing these guidelines, you can raise your credit score over time.

Protect Your Credit Score: Monitor For Fraud and Identity Theft
In today's digital world, your credit score is more vulnerable than ever to malicious activity. Monitoring your credit report regularly is the most effective way about detect any inaccurate activity and protect yourself from identity theft. By scrutinizing your credit report regularly, you can swiftly correct any errors before they escalate into major difficulties.
- Think about using a credit monitoring service that supplies regular updates on your report.
- Examine your credit report every month for any unknown accounts, transactions, or requests.
- Notify any suspicious activity to the credit bureaus and relevant agencies.
Remember, your credit score is a vital part of your financial well-being. By taking proactive steps to monitor it, you can protect your financial future and reduce the risk of identity theft.
